ATHLETICS.
NEW ZEALAND CHAMPIONSHIP MEETING. , i 1 by TELEGRAPH—PI'ESS association. j 1 WELLINGTON, February 1. j The New Zealand Championship Athletic meeting was held on the 1 Basin Reserve this afternoon. The I performances in the field events were i poor, and both walking contests were ( robbed of a good deal of interest ( owing to a couple of contestants being disqualified in each event. Welling- , ton retains the Championship Shield, 1 < scoring 79$ points. Canterbury scored I I 41 points, Southland 13, Auckland j 6, Otago SJ.
